[0018] Below in conjunction with accompanying drawing, the present invention is described in further detail:

[0019] figure 1 A schematic diagram of the appearance structure of the wheel auxiliary support inner tire 10 of the present invention is shown. It mainly includes an air-free supporting carcass 11 and a connecting device 21 .

[0020] Considering the needs of weight reduction and heat dissipation, a plurality of weight reduction and heat dissipation holes 12 are evenly arranged on the air-free supporting carcass. Such weight-reducing cooling holes 12 can be arranged on any side of the air-free supporting carcass 11 under the premise of not affecting the structural strength.

[0021] The connecting device 21 is a buckle for connecting and tightening the air-free supporting carcass.

[0022] Such as figure 2 As shown, the wheel auxiliary support inner tube 10 of the present invention is installed in the tire 02 and on the wheel rim 01 .

Abstract

The invention discloses a wheel auxiliary support inner tube, which comprises an inflatable-free support carcass and a connecting device. The support carcass is attached to the wheel rim by means of aconnecting device. The invention has the advantages of simple structure, safety and reliability, can provide auxiliary support for a pressure-losing tire, ensures that the vehicle can safely travel to a maintenance site, and saves the setting of a spare tire of the vehicle.

Description

technical field [0001] The invention relates to the field of vehicle tires, in particular to a wheel auxiliary support inner tube. Background technique [0002] The lack of air and pressure in the tires during the driving of the vehicle directly affects the safety of the drivers and passengers. [0003] In order to prevent such accidents, a relatively mature solution in this field is the run-flat tire. This type of technology thickens the tire wall and continues to support the vehicle to drive safely after the tire is completely depressurized. However, the disadvantages of this type of technology are The thicker tire wall is contradicted by the shock absorption function of the tire, which greatly sacrifices the driving comfort. In addition, this technology is only applicable to small passenger cars with low vehicle curb weight, and its application is limited.
